What they do
BUILDING ON THE ENDURING HERITAGE and VALUES SHARED BETWEEN THE PEOPLES of THE NETHERLANDS and THE UNITED STATES, THE NETHERLAND-AMERICA FOUNDATION SEEKS to FURTHER STRENGTHEN THE BONDS BETWEEN OUR TWO COUNTRIES THROUGH EXCHANGE IN THE ARTS,SCIENCES, EDUCATION, BUSINESS and PUBLIC AFFAIRS.
